The cream of NSW's indoor cricketers are in action in Maitland this weekend for the annual state titles.

The titles hit off tonight at the Maitland Indoor Sports Centre, in Rutherford, and run through to the finals on Sunday.
The Maitland Panthers, who play in the Northern NSW divistion, have three teams in this year’s title.
“It’s a big achievement. It’s the first time we have qualified this many teams since we have been in the Northern NSW competition,” Mens 1 skipper Barry Richards said.
The three best teams from Sydney and the three best teams from country across the four grades, premier, men’s 2, men’s 3 and masters.
“The country teams will be drawn against the Sydney teams in the preliminary rounds,” Richards said.
“Teams will have one game on Friday and two games on Saturday.
“The finals on Sunday will be semi-finals between first and fourth and second and third, with the winners of both going into grand finals.
“It will be action packed with games pretty much constantly going on.
“We’d love fans to come along and support the Maitland teams and just get to see what an exciting sport it is.”
Games start at 7pm on Friday, from 9am on Saturday and 9.30am on Sunday. Entry is free and there are refreshments and food available at the canteen.
